GGGGGGGG - I'm still waiting for my reverse and tail lights (ordered the last week of December from everything35.com) - hope to get mine soon. I've seen a few people mention that the reverse light installation took a bit more work - why? Also, how did you remove the black "Pull" handle on the inside lip of the trunk (i.e. the one that you grab to close the trunk?
fieldsie, the reason y reverse lights took me a while to tackle was that I had a really hard time removing trunk "Pull" handle. Eventually, I just gave up and did the reverse lights without removing the entire trunk lid inner lining- it was still easy though. Just watch out for those sharp edges around the trunk lid lining when you are trying to hold did during the installation. I got cut several times trying to hold it.
